I just wanted to ask why you gas steal terran because I saw that you did it quite often. | ||
desRow
Canada2654 Posts
On January 15 2011 21:05 Eviltoast wrote: Thanks I enjoyed watching some of them. I just wanted to ask why you gas steal terran because I saw that you did it quite often. I gas steal for extra information. I can poke back in my probe to see if they go 1-1-1 or 2racks and if they dont kill it they go 2racks all in with no expo if they kill in they go 2 racks fe (or what ive seen so far =P) A lot of good players gas steal like Nv.xiaot and naniwa (not totally sure about the latter) | ||
